Successful Study Methods for Exam Preparation

To enhance exam preparation in chemistry, students should embrace effective study strategies that encourage understanding and retention of material. One key approach is to create a structured study schedule, allocating specific times for different topics while ensuring regular review sessions. Employing active learning techniques, such as condensing concepts in your own copyright or teaching the material to a peer, can considerably improve comprehension.

Moreover, students should include practice problems, as these solidify knowledge and pinpoint areas that necessitate further attention. Working with different resources, including textbooks, online platforms, and study groups, cultivates a deeper understanding of complex concepts. Utilizing mnemonic devices or visual aids can also enhance memory retention.

In conclusion, students should prioritize a balanced study environment—eliminating distractions and maintaining adequate breaks—to boost focus and ward off burnout. By utilizing these strategies, students can efficiently prepare for their chemistry exams, setting themselves for success.

Common Questions

What Credentials Should I Look for in a Chemistry Tutor?

In choosing a chemistry tutor, one must prioritize qualifications including a strong academic background in chemistry, relevant teaching experience, good communication skills, and a solid track record of helping students achieve their academic goals.

What's the Ideal Timeframe to Start Tutoring Before an Exam?

Optimally, students should commence tutoring sessions at least four to six weeks in advance of an exam. This timeline allows for complete review, practice of difficult concepts, and sufficient time to address any lingering questions or challenges.

Can Online Tutoring Sessions Be as Effective as In-Person Instruction?

Research demonstrates that online tutoring sessions can be just as effective as face-to-face sessions, given that the tutor engages students actively and utilizes suitable tools. Student preferences and learning styles may affect effectiveness, however.

What's the Average Price for Chemistry Tutoring Services?

Typical pricing of chemistry tutoring connected information services varies from $25 to $100 per hour, determined by factors such as the tutor's experience, location, and whether the sessions are provided online or in person.
